NEMA.SW stock fundamentals and valuation
Nemetschek shows trailing EPS of CHF1.60 and a reported PE of 39.00 while TTM PE metrics in our data read 51.26. Revenue per share is CHF7.06 and book value per share is CHF6.85. Key valuation ratios: price/sales 8.84, price/book 9.51 and EV/sales 9.15, indicating a premium versus Technology peers (sector avg PE 30.01). Current ratio is 0.74, and debt/equity stands at 0.62, which flags liquidity constraints versus sector norms.

NEMA.SW stock sector context and catalysts
Nemetschek operates in the Software – Application industry within Technology and competes in BIM and 3D rendering. Technology sector metrics show avg PE 30.01 and avg ROE 18.59%; Nemetschek’s ROE is 17.07%, near sector norms but valuation is richer. Near-term catalysts include the 19 Mar 2026 earnings release and ongoing demand in architecture, construction and media verticals under brands like Allplan, Graphisoft and Maxon. Sector performance has been mixed YTD, so company-specific results will likely drive price action.
NEMA.SW stock risks, cash flow and dividend metrics
Free cash flow per share is CHF2.19 and operating cash flow per share is CHF2.27, giving a FCF yield around 3.50%. Dividend per share is CHF0.52, implying a yield near 0.83%. Risks include high price/book (9.51) and a cash conversion cycle of 48.75 days, which could pressure short-term liquidity. Interest coverage at 7.79 suggests manageable interest costs, but the current ratio below 1.0 remains a caution for conservative investors.
